ReBUILDLA™ First Fire Relief Distribution Brings Hope to 500+ Families ReBUILDLA™ successfully hosted its first official fire relief distribution event, bringing vital aid to more than 500 families impacted by recent wildfires. The event, a collaborative effort between San Gabriel Valley Habitat for Humanity (SGV Habitat), Habitat for Humanity of Greater Los Angeles (Habitat GLA), and Sit 'n Sleep, provided much-needed support to survivors as they begin the process of rebuilding their lives. Households that completed the Relief Assistance Form and RSVP’d received essential supplies, including brand-new mattresses generously donated by Sit 'n Sleep. In addition to mattresses, attendees took home air purifiers, ReStore vouchers, sheets, pillows, and other crucial household items aimed at helping them recover and rebuild. “It was incredibly moving to witness the gratitude and relief on the faces of those we served,” said Miriam Garcia, Director of Retail Operations. “The Sit 'n Sleep Distribution Event was a huge success! Seeing the smiles on everyone's faces as they drove away with items that many of us take for granted was both emotional and joyous. It was a powerful reminder of the impact we can make as a community.” The dedicated teams from SGV Habitat and Habitat GLA worked tirelessly throughout the day to ensure the event ran smoothly, providing families with the support they needed. The event concluded with a surprise visit from Bob, the beloved Minion. ReBUILDLA™ remains committed to providing ongoing relief and long-term rebuilding efforts for wildfire survivors.
